1
223

컨트롤러에 @ResponseBody 선언시 인터셉터에서 오류가...


안녕하세요 선선한 가을입니다.

비동기로 처리하고 싶은 데이터가 있어서 컨트롤러에 @ResponseBody 에노테이션을 적용했더니

로그인 유무를 처리해주는 인터셉터에서 NullPointerException이 발생 하네요

다른건 수정 안하고 컨트롤러에 적용되어 있는 @ResponseBody 에노테이션만 빼면 에러없이 잘 작동 하구요

혹시나 싶어서 <mvc:exclude-mapping path="/*Ajax.kws"/> 이렇게 비동기통신은 해당 인터셉터를 타지 않게 했는데도

계속 똑같은 오류가 발생하네요

@ResponseBody 에노테이션이랑 인터셉터랑 무슨 상관관계가 있는거 같기도 하고

고수님들 이런 경우는 어떻게 처리해야 할까요?

0
0
  • 답변 1

  • DPJ
    503
    2018-09-18 23:06:07

    디버깅해서 NPE가 어디서 나는지 찾아야죠

    0
  • 로그인을 하시면 답변을 등록할 수 있습니다.